Those didactis principles which are of the greatest importance in chemistry from the standpoint of the function and calculation are elaborated here: the principle of scientificity, the principle of objectivity, the principle of the connection of the theory and practice, the principle of activity, the principle of the individual approach, the principle of the back-feed, the principle of the didactic and rational effectivity.
An important didactic aspect of the computerization is the choice of the teaching content suitable for the computer elaborating. From the existing approaches to the choice of teaching items suitable for the programming we consider that way of choosing the teaching materials to be suitable for the grammar school the acquiring of which have heen the trouble spots when applying traditional ways of their elaborating.
We consider those programmes to be optimal for the basic and grammar school learners that make the learners take an active part in the lesson.
